Veterinary expenses can be substantial if your pet suddenly becomes ill or injured.

Pet owners will spend a record $34.3 billion on veterinary care and related expenses in 2021, American Pet Products Association (APPA). If the potential for expensive vet bills worries you, pet insurance may be an option worth exploring to help offset the cost.

Pet insurance works much like human health insurance. You pay a monthly premium for a policy that covers (or compensation) costs of unexpected injuries, illnesses and other conditions. This insurance is relatively inexpensive, but it can be a financial lifesaver if you’re suddenly faced with a hefty vet bill.

How much is pet insurance for a dog?

Generally, dog insurance is more expensive than cat insurance because dogs are usually larger and require more medications and treatments for veterinary procedures. Coverage premiums for dogs range from $10 to $100 per month, with average costs between $30 and $50.

Several factors contribute to this Premium amount The amount you pay depends on your dog’s breed, age and where you live. As with human health insurance, you’ll pay more for an older dog than a puppy, because health problems are more likely.

Depending on your policy, your pet insurance may help your dog get the treatment it needs for accidental injuries, illnesses or hereditary conditions. Some providers allow you to purchase add-on coverage plans for routine care, dental care, preventive procedures and prescriptions.

Which dog breeds are the cheapest to insure?

The cost of dog insurance coverage can be cheap or expensive depending on your dog Breeding. Breeds that statistically carry a higher likelihood of health problems will generally cost more to insure. Breeds that are known for living longer, healthier lives generally carry lower insurance premiums.

LendEDU analyzed the data Spot Pet Insurance has discovered around 114 dog and cat breeds and the most affordable dog breeds to insure are the English Springer Spaniel, Miniature Yorkshire Terrier and Goldendoodle. Premiums for these varieties range from about $34 to $40 per month. Not surprisingly, the first two breeds are small dogs, and all three are known to live long lives.

You might think mixed breeds are more expensive to insure, but that’s not the case. Because mixed breeds are less likely to inherit genetic-specific health problems, their premiums are generally more affordable than their purebred counterparts.

Which dog breeds are expensive to insure?

Some dog breeds are more expensive to insure because their breed is prone to certain diseases and conditions.

For example, Rottweilers are often more expensive to insure in part because they are more affected by hip dysplasia than other breeds. Fetch by The Dodo, which says its average monthly premium for all dog breeds is $35, quoted a $45.86 premium for a 2-year-old Rottweiler in St. Louis with a $5,000 limit, an 80% reimbursement rate and a $300 deductible.

According to a LendEDU study, the most expensive dog breeds to insure are the Newfoundland, Dogue de Bordeaux and Jack Russell Terrier, with monthly premiums of about $90 to $100. “Newfies” and the Dogue De Bordeaux are large animals weighing upwards of 140 to 150 pounds, while all three breeds are susceptible to breed-specific health problems.
